Transaction 60dac26eb76f314b6ea1472f01f08f67905958e9e4d96e6582ed68e01812d7f7
1 Input
1 Output
-
60dac26eb76f314b6ea1472f01f08f67905958e9e4d96e6582ed68e01812d7f7:0
- value
- 271640
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 530d1f2682da97b32c185aa96a3aa93a93744e98 OP_EQUAL
- address
- 39G9jBAbrsGSkBHwanbPCofmkfywMPKDcB